On 11/21 02:50 , Jan Kellermann wrote: > And now my question. Is there a way to remove my 20 testing backups from > the backuplist, or is the only way to wait till they doesn't match > fullkeepcnt an the nightly job will delete them?
You can just delete the backups at the filesystem level. /var/lib/backuppc/pc/<hostname>/<backup number> is where they're stored (at least on Debian boxen, YMMV). You may want to edit the 'backups' file as well, to remove the ones in question.
